Discription of Pilosocereus Pachycladus
Height 1 to 2 feet. Pilosocereus Pachycladus commonly know as the ‘Blue Columnar Cactus’ is a unique addition to every plant family. Unlike most indoor plants, this Cactus brings a blue shade to your plant colour palette. The plants colour and natural, soft-grey coating contrasts the Cactus spikes, a true work of art by the natural world. It is a very low maintenance plant that can be cared for by anyone, including children.
Like all cacti, the Pilosocereus Pachycladus goes dormant during winter and should be watered very sparingly during this time and kept in a bright, cool position by a window. In summer the plant should be watered more regularly and kept in a very bright space.

Pilosocereus Pachycladus Plant Care
Pilosocereus Pachycladus ‘Blue Columnar Cactus’ has spikes which can cause some irritation and therefore touching the plant should be avoided not only for the sake of the plant, but also for your own precious fingers.
Size
- This plant is about 15 cm tall and comes in a plastic nursery pot 13cm big in diameter.
Care Tips
- Bright morning sun, some air flow, avoid touching the plant.
Light
- Dull sun but can tolerate low light
Water for Pilosocereus Pachycladus Plant
- Sparingly, once per month in winter, once every week and half in summer
Soil
- Fast draining potting mix like cactus mix.
Fertilizer
- During the active growing season in spring and summer, fertilize your Pilosocereus pachycladus approximately once every 4-6 weeks.
- Reduce or stop using fertilizer during the fall and winter when the plant is dormant.
Uses of Pilosocereus Pachycladus Plant
- People primarily grow Pilosocereus pachycladus for ornamental purposes in gardens, landscapes, and indoor settings because of its striking appearance.
- It features tall, columnar stems and ranges in color from bluish-green to blue-gray.
- Moreover, the plant may carry cultural significance in regions where it is native or widely cultivated, often appearing in folklore, art, or religious ceremonies.
- In certain cultures, traditional medicine uses extracts or preparations from various parts of the cactus to treat ailments such as inflammation, digestive issues, and wounds.
